A Republican
lawmaker says no one at the U.S. State Department has been held accountable for
actions that may have contributed to the deaths of four Americans in Benghazi,
Libya, including the four employees who were put on leave and then reinstated
in different State Department jobs. “Reassignment
does not equal accountability,” Rep. Trey Radel (R-Fla.) said on Wednesday at a
House Foreign Affairs Committee hearing on the Sept. 11, 2012 terror attack. “They’re reassigned. They are being put
into another position where they’ve never missed a paycheck, where they’re going
to have their cushy government job, and they’re still going to get a pension,”
Radel said. “In the real world this would never happen. This would never, ever
happen
“They would be
